This Aussie documentary follows director Jonathan Duffy and his boyfriend Vincent Cornelisse as they leave the Melbourne suburbs and head to rural Queensland, so that Vincent can take up a job as a doctor there, helping to pay back the scholarship he got during his studies.
They’re both concerned about how they’ll be received, as the country parts of Australia aren’t well known for their love of the gays. Jonathan in particular is worried, as he’s more noticeably gay and isn’t sure what his role will be once he gets to Mundubbera, a town of about 1,000 people. The film chronicles their arrival, the reaction of the locals and how Vincent and Jonathan find a way to fit in and be accepted in their new home. [Read more…]
